My daddy is a mechanic. He works on cars. Daddy Petey is Pearuhmedick. He works on people. I like it when we all make speghetti for dinner cuz they let me sit on a stool and stir the saws.

 

"Very good Dylan. I like your report on your family. The picture you drew is very colorful! There are a few spelling mistakes to fix though, I've underlined the words. Why don't you look them up in your writing dictionary?" Miss Hanson handed back his report and Dylan walked back over to his chair at his table group.

 

He got out his writing notebook and pulled out his dictionary to get started. He wanted his report to go on the fridge and Daddy said only the best went on the fridge. At least once a week he managed to get something on there. Last week it was his maths, he only missed three problems!

 

Dylan bit down on his tongue as he erased the first word. He was pretty sure Daddy Petey's job started with a p so he looked there first. Sure enough, Paramedic, had been added to the page. He carefully copied the letters. He was working on the next one when Maxine Winters looked at his paper and then looked at him funny. Dylan tried to ignore her; she wasn't very nice. He fixed spaghetti and was moving on to cuz when she started talking.

 

"Hey, Dylan. How come your paper says you have two daddies? Where is your mommy? My mommy says all kids should have one daddy and one mommy and everything else is just weird." Her smug little face made him mad and he didn't like the way she was looking at his picture. "And she says it's wrong. Really bad wrong like when you steal or lie and stuff."

 

"Well my mommy went to heaven and my daddy says that she sent Daddy Petey to make us happy. I don't care what your mommy says." Dylan glared at her. Maxine glared back and opened her mouth. Just then Miss Hanson told their table to get back to work. Dylan stuck his tongue out at Maxine when Miss Hanson couldn't see and then started working on his paper again. He liked his family report and he liked Daddy Petey!

One thing, you need to watch your dialogue punctuation. If you use a ! or ? then right after the quotations the word still needs to be in lowercase unless it's a proper noun like a name. You were fine on that part. The main thing I noticed is the more confusing , or . when it comes to the punctuation. Basically you end with a comma and the quotations if you use a speech tag such as he said, she said. If the text you have coming after the dialogue is an action, he winked, I smiled or there is neither a tag or action then the dialogue ends with a period.

 

This should have a period since it's an action. “I’ve got to ring Mathew baby, the car won’t start again,” I smiled down into his beautiful face.

 

This has neither speech or action, so a period is needed. “Ha-ha I’m your husband not your boyfriend, and I’ll miss you too,”

 

 

This is a little different when you miss action/tags/dialogue. I would make the comma after disgusting a period instead of the comma. The would be capitalized. I would keep the comma after hand but put a comma after shit. Sometimes laughed can be a speech tag or an action depending on the dialogue. “That sounds disgusting,” the young man grinned and offered his hand, “Hi I’m Adam Warner, and you look like shit” he laughed.

A Lucky Disaster

 

Great, I have topped myself this time: standing naked on a high stool that broke one of its legs just as I got up on it. If I would move an inch, I might crash to the full bathtub, where I had managed to drop a hair dryer that I had not turned off. To make my situation even worse, the electrified, deadly water had started to pour over the tub to the bathroom floor. Thank God the stool was plastic! There was no safe place to land now. I was literally hanging from the lamp, trying to balance on the now three legged stool until my roommate would return. Gosh, I was such a doofus.

 

I knew better not to go changing the bulb by myself. Yet I did it anyways. Over the years I have proven time and time again I am a walking, talking disaster. Now, even our cat was laughing at me, sitting at the doorway.

 

I hope the cat had more sense than to step into the water on the floor. “Shush ! Go and make something useful of yourself and get help… If only you had a thumb and could talk… Now you are useless.”

 

As I watched Leo turned around and vanish from my sight, I let out a small cry. I would start screaming for help, but I knew there was no one else around in our small dorm at the moment. If only I had brought my cell with me in the bathroom.

 

After about fifteen minutes, I heard a door open, making me almost faint. It had to be Samson, no one else had a key. “Sam!” I hollered. “I need some help in here, but be careful… Saaaaa---aaam!”

 

But it wasn’t Sam who came to the door. It was Sam’s best friend Joshua who stood there assessing the situation. I’ve been crushing on him for ages. ‘Shit.’

 

“Don’t make a move.” His voice was stern and commanding. “How the hell did you get in that situation?”

 

I think my muscles were going to cramp any time now for being still in an awkward position, hands above my head, for what seemed like an eternity. I wanted to say something witty back, but I was too tired.

 

“I don’t think I can move. Please help me out of here.”

 

Suddenly I became very aware of his gaze on my nude body. I could do nothing to cover myself. I started to shudder.

 

“For God’s sake, keep still! I will be right back.”

 

Within seconds the power – and all lights - went out from our apartment, but I still didn’t dare to move.

 

“Where do you keep your mechanic’s box?” I heard Joshua yell from the other room.

 

“Under the kitchen sink,” I yelped with a weak-ish voice.

 

Joshua came back with a flash light. “You are still there? You can come down now. It is safe.”

 

I still couldn’t move, maybe I was in a shock.

 

“I’m coming to get you down.” Joshua grabbed a robe hanging at the wall and took the few steps separating us. The robe over his shoulders, he put his arms around my waist and lifted me up from the stool then landed me down.

 

I think the shock started to decrease as I finally allowed myself to lower my hands – on Joshua’s chest – and collapsed against him in cries.

 

“There, there now. You are safe.”

 

“How can I ever thank you for saving my life?” I croaked. “Let me take you for a dinner.” f**k. That sounded like I was asking him out on a date!

 

“Nah, it was my pleasure, Connor. I came here to get Sam’s books he had forgotten for the algebra class that he was not able to get for himself.” Joshua tightened his grip over my waist. “What do you say if you’d cook me dinner?”

 

“Are you serious? Don’t you remember what a lousy cook I am? All I can do is spaghetti with ketchup.”

 

“Spaghetti with ketchup sounds fine to me. But I will stand next to you just in case so that you’d try to burn the kitchen this time.”

 

I lifted my eyes and met Joshua’s. There was a definite spark in them that I had not seen before.

 

“Meeeoooow.” A demanding comment from the bathroom door startled the both of us. Leo looked pissed in the flash light that kJoshua pointed at him.

 

“I think he has been waiting impatiently to get to his cat litter.” I took the robe from Sam and put it around me and threw a towel to the floor to dry some of the water. “There you go, dear.”

 

“Are you sure you don’t want to go to a restaurant?”

 

“Connor, do you always have to be this stubborn?”

 

“Well alright, just blame yourself if you end up hungry.”

 

“I already am.” Joshua looked me with a clear desire in his eyes.

 

I swallowed hard. This can’t be happening… “What do you say we skip the spaghetti and go straight to the dessert?” I can’t believe I am being this forward!

 

“Deal!”

 

We sealed our compromise with a passionate kiss.
